In AED Mode, the Paramedic CU-ER5 analyzes the ECG of the patient to determine whether the patient has a shockable or nonshockable ECG rhythm. In this mode, the Paramedic CU-ER5 provides you with voice and text prompts throughout a rescue operation.
In Manual External Defibrillation Mode, the Paramedic CU-ER5 lets you control the defibrillation process. The Paramedic CU-ER5 is used with reusable external paddles. You assess the ECG of the patient and set the energy of the shock to be delivered. You may also perform synchronous cardioversion for the treatment of atrial fibrillation in this mode. In synchronous cardioversion, the defibrillating shock is delivered within 60 milliseconds of the occurrence of a QRS peak in the patient's ECG.
ECG and SpO2 monitoring |
|
In Monitoring Mode, the Paramedic CU-ER5 acquires ECG through 3 or 5 Lead ECG cable and SpO2 signals from the patient. Various alarms may be activated in this mode. This mode is also used in tandem with the manual modes in order to get a display of the patient's ECG rhythm. |

Intelligent Data Management System |
|
The Paramedic CU-ER5 automatically records ECG and events such as shock deliveries in nonvolatile memory during rescue operations. These data may be printed directly using a portable printer or downloaded to a personal computer for printing and archiving. |

Versatile Power Supply |
|
The Paramedic CU-ER5 is powered by an internal rechargeable Nickel Metal Hydride battery pack. It may also be powered by an optional external disposable LiMnO2 battery pack or its AC/DC adapter. While the internal battery is being recharged by the AC/DC adapter, the AC/DC adapter also supplies power to the whole device which enables it to be fully functional. |

Automatic and operator initiated Self-Test |
|
The Paramedic CU-ER5 is easy to troubleshoot and maintain. It is programmed to conduct automatic Power On, Run Time, Daily, Weekly, and Monthly self tests. During these tests, the critical subsystems of the device are tested for functionality. If a fault is detected, the device informs you of the fault through audible and visible indicators. |
